Hi How can i allow my pioneer dv 250 to play my all zone pal disc? Do i have to buy a converter if it exists? Where can i find one or is there a way to unlock the player?

A converter is to expensive to buy. You are better off buying a cheap DVD player that has this conversion feature built in and can be made region free. For example the Philips DVD-634, Philipps DVD-724, Norcent DP-300, Apex 1100W, Lenoxx DVD-2003, Prima 1500 and Malata 520 offer this possibility. This website is very informative on this subject:

P.S. DVD models that can play VCDs in North America often have a built in PAL to NTSC converter, given that many VCDs are in PAL format. So I am bit surprised to hear you say that the Pioneer DV-250 doesn't have this. I am tempted to think that it does.
